The alphabetical table and concordance of the Decretum Gratiani and the Decretals composed by Martinus Polonus, and entitled Alphabetum Decreti et Decretalium, Margarita Decreti, Summa (or, Vocabularium) Juris Canonici or (Summa) Martiniana. Here without title, but the preface mentions the author's name.

This volume may doubtfully be taken to represent the 'Anon. in Iule' (i. e. Jure?), which appears among the Folio Law books in the earliest catalogue (1602). It has a neglected appearance, and escaped the 1605 catalogue, first appearing (as T. 11. 11 Jur.) in the 1620 lists, though the entry of it in the handlist of 1614 may be of that date

200 lines of a lexicographical poem on Greek words, chiefly Latin words derived from Greek, with glosses and scribbling. Two lines in the S section are 'Cantica sunt psalmi: psalteria musica quedam | Sunt instrumenta que dicas organa nabla'
